{"formats":[{"name":"JSON","format":"json","url":"\/downloads\/2025\/code-json\/54.1-3435.01.json"},{"name":"Plain Text","format":"text","url":"\/downloads\/2025\/code-text\/54.1-3435.01.txt"},{"name":"XML","format":"xml","url":"\/downloads\/2025\/code-xml\/54.1-3435.01.xml"},{"name":"HTML","format":"html","url":"\/downloads\/2025\/code-html\/54.1-3435.01.html"}],"law_id":87353,"edition_id":1,"section_id":87353,"structure_id":13241,"section_number":"54.1-3435.01","catch_line":"Registration of nonresident wholesale distributors; renewal; fee","history":"1994, c. 300; 2008, c. 320; 2015, c. 299; 2016, c. 221.","full_text":"A\n\nAny person located outside the Commonwealth who engages in the wholesale distribution of prescription drugs into the Commonwealth shall be registered with the Board. The applicant for registration as a nonresident wholesale distributor shall apply to the Board using such forms as the Board may furnish; renew such registration, if granted, using such forms as the Board may furnish, annually on a date determined by the Board in regulation; notify the Board within 30 days of any substantive change in the information previously submitted to the Board; and remit a fee, which shall be the fee specified for wholesale distributors located within the Commonwealth.B\n\nThe nonresident wholesale distributor shall at all times maintain a valid, unexpired license, permit, or registration in the state in which it is located and shall furnish proof of such upon application and at each renewal.C\n\nRecords of prescription drugs distributed into the Commonwealth shall be maintained in such a manner that they are readily retrievable from records of distributions into other jurisdictions and shall be provided to the Board, its authorized agent, or any agent designated by the Superintendent of State Police upon request within seven days of receipt of such request.D\n\nA nonresident wholesale distributor that ceases distribution of Schedule II through V drugs to a pharmacy, licensed physician dispenser, or licensed physician dispensing facility located in the Commonwealth due to suspicious orders of controlled substances shall notify the Board within five days of the cessation. For the purposes of this section, &#8220;suspicious orders of controlled substances&#8221; means, relative to the pharmacy&#8217;s, licensed physician dispenser&#8217;s, or licensed physician dispensing facility&#8217;s order history and the order history of similarly situated pharmacies, licensed physician dispensers, or licensed physician dispensing facilities, (i) orders of unusual size, (ii) orders deviating substantially from a normal pattern, and (iii) orders of unusual frequency.E\n\nA nonresident wholesale distributor shall be immune from civil liability for giving notice in accordance with subsection D unless the notice was given in bad faith or with malicious intent.F\n\nThe Board shall not impose any disciplinary or enforcement action against any licensee or permit holder solely on the basis of a notice received from a nonresident wholesale distributor pursuant to subsection D.G\n\nThis section shall not apply to persons who distribute prescription drugs directly to a licensed wholesale distributor located within the Commonwealth.H\n\nEvery nonresident wholesale distributor shall comply with federal requirements for an electronic, interoperable system to identify, trace, and verify prescription drugs as they are distributed.","order_by":null,"text":{"0":{"id":312802,"text":"Any person located outside the Commonwealth who engages in the wholesale distribution of prescription drugs into the Commonwealth shall be registered with the Board.
